在電腦系統(tǒng)中,我們可以使用軟件來(lái)控制光驅(qū)的運(yùn)轉(zhuǎn)、讀取光盤等功能。那么,怎樣才能讓軟件可以控制光驅(qū)呢?
1.安裝驅(qū)動(dòng)程序
在使用光驅(qū)之前,需要先安裝驅(qū)動(dòng)程序。一般情況下,操作系統(tǒng)會(huì)自動(dòng)安裝光驅(qū)驅(qū)動(dòng)程序。如果發(fā)現(xiàn)光驅(qū)不能正常工作,可以嘗試重新安裝驅(qū)動(dòng)程序。
2.軟件調(diào)用API
軟件在控制光驅(qū)時(shí),需要調(diào)用操作系統(tǒng)提供的應(yīng)用程序接口(API)。這些接口包括讀寫光盤、控制光驅(qū)開關(guān)等功能。在編寫軟件時(shí),需要根據(jù)API的要求來(lái)調(diào)用相應(yīng)的接口。
3.注冊(cè)表設(shè)置
操作系統(tǒng)會(huì)在注冊(cè)表中存儲(chǔ)光驅(qū)相關(guān)的設(shè)置。例如,光驅(qū)的讀寫速度、自動(dòng)啟動(dòng)等功能。軟件需要讀取這些設(shè)置來(lái)控制光驅(qū)的運(yùn)行。
4.軟件自帶驅(qū)動(dòng)程序
某些軟件在安裝時(shí)會(huì)自帶光驅(qū)驅(qū)動(dòng)程序。這種情況下,軟件可以直接控制光驅(qū)運(yùn)行,而無(wú)需調(diào)用操作系統(tǒng)提供的API。
5.光驅(qū)控制器
有些計(jì)算機(jī)硬件設(shè)備可以用于控制光驅(qū),這些設(shè)備稱為光驅(qū)控制器。通過(guò)光驅(qū)控制器,軟件可以更加精確地控制光驅(qū)的運(yùn)行狀態(tài)。
6.應(yīng)用領(lǐng)域
軟件控制光驅(qū)的應(yīng)用廣泛,例如光盤復(fù)制、光驅(qū)模擬等。在這些應(yīng)用中,軟件需要能夠精確地控制光驅(qū)的運(yùn)行狀態(tài),并讀取光盤中的數(shù)據(jù)。
總的來(lái)說(shuō),軟件控制光驅(qū)的關(guān)鍵在于該軟件是否能夠調(diào)用系統(tǒng)提供的API,并且需要讀取操作系統(tǒng)中存儲(chǔ)的光驅(qū)設(shè)置。同時(shí),光驅(qū)硬件設(shè)備的驅(qū)動(dòng)程序也需要正常安裝。